Output 8fd98e6b82ff95e9eebc456d91e0c7799b4aabe54b2f06456b186add5320a3f8:6

value
17655296090
script pubkey
OP_0 OP_PUSHBYTES_20 f05ca0933738059e830756042263a8d8182b9f24
address
tb1q7pw2pyeh8qzeaqc82czzycagmqvzh8eysdca4m
transaction
8fd98e6b82ff95e9eebc456d91e0c7799b4aabe54b2f06456b186add5320a3f8
confirmations
13729
spent
true